mirror of
https://review.haiku-os.org/buildtools
synced 2024-11-23 07:18:49 +01:00
jam: update default paths in Jambase
Running "./jam0 install" installed jam in /boot/common/bin/ which is no longer used. Other directories also looked outdated so they are updated too. Test plan: 1. make 2. ./jam0 install Install /boot/system/non-packaged/bin/jam 3. which jam /boot/system/non-packaged/bin/jam Change-Id: I69c719eab0bd211f545c17337e3bc73bb1ab78fe Reviewed-on: https://review.haiku-os.org/c/buildtools/+/4617 Reviewed-by: waddlesplash <waddlesplash@gmail.com>
This commit is contained in:
parent
4b7b6c63e8
commit
72c791bc1f
10
jam/Jambase
10
jam/Jambase
@ -135,7 +135,7 @@
|
|||||||
|
|
||||||
# for perforce use -- jambase version
|
# for perforce use -- jambase version
|
||||||
|
|
||||||
JAMBASEDATE = 2020.09.16 ;
|
JAMBASEDATE = 2021.10.20 ;
|
||||||
|
|
||||||
# Initialize variables
|
# Initialize variables
|
||||||
#
|
#
|
||||||
@ -248,7 +248,7 @@ if $(NT) {
|
|||||||
YACCFILES ?= y.tab ;
|
YACCFILES ?= y.tab ;
|
||||||
YACCFLAGS ?= -d ;
|
YACCFLAGS ?= -d ;
|
||||||
} else if $(OS) = HAIKU {
|
} else if $(OS) = HAIKU {
|
||||||
BINDIR ?= /boot/common/bin ;
|
BINDIR ?= /boot/system/non-packaged/bin ;
|
||||||
CC ?= gcc ;
|
CC ?= gcc ;
|
||||||
C++ ?= $(CC) ;
|
C++ ?= $(CC) ;
|
||||||
CHMOD ?= chmod ;
|
CHMOD ?= chmod ;
|
||||||
@ -256,11 +256,11 @@ if $(NT) {
|
|||||||
CHOWN ?= chown ;
|
CHOWN ?= chown ;
|
||||||
FORTRAN ?= "" ;
|
FORTRAN ?= "" ;
|
||||||
LEX ?= flex ;
|
LEX ?= flex ;
|
||||||
LIBDIR ?= /boot/common/lib ;
|
LIBDIR ?= /boot/system/non-packaged/lib ;
|
||||||
LINK ?= gcc ;
|
LINK ?= gcc ;
|
||||||
MANDIR ?= /boot/common/man ;
|
MANDIR ?= /boot/system/non-packaged/documentation/man ;
|
||||||
RANLIB ?= ranlib ;
|
RANLIB ?= ranlib ;
|
||||||
STDHDRS ?= /boot/develop/headers/posix ;
|
STDHDRS ?= /boot/system/develop/headers/posix ;
|
||||||
YACC ?= bison -y ;
|
YACC ?= bison -y ;
|
||||||
YACCGEN ?= .c ;
|
YACCGEN ?= .c ;
|
||||||
YACCFILES ?= y.tab ;
|
YACCFILES ?= y.tab ;
|
||||||
|
@ -1,7 +1,7 @@
|
|||||||
/* Generated by mkjambase from Jambase */
|
/* Generated by mkjambase from Jambase */
|
||||||
const char *jambase[] = {
|
const char *jambase[] = {
|
||||||
/* Jambase */
|
/* Jambase */
|
||||||
"JAMBASEDATE = 2018.11.21 ;\n",
|
"JAMBASEDATE = 2021.10.20 ;\n",
|
||||||
"if $(NT) {\n",
|
"if $(NT) {\n",
|
||||||
"MV ?= move /y ;\n",
|
"MV ?= move /y ;\n",
|
||||||
"CP ?= copy ;\n",
|
"CP ?= copy ;\n",
|
||||||
@ -12,7 +12,8 @@ const char *jambase[] = {
|
|||||||
"SUFOBJ ?= .obj ;\n",
|
"SUFOBJ ?= .obj ;\n",
|
||||||
"SUFEXE ?= .exe ;\n",
|
"SUFEXE ?= .exe ;\n",
|
||||||
"if $(MSVC) {\n",
|
"if $(MSVC) {\n",
|
||||||
"AR ?= lib /nologo ;\n",
|
"AR ?= lib ;\n",
|
||||||
|
"ARFLAGS ?= /nologo ;\n",
|
||||||
"CC ?= cl /nologo ;\n",
|
"CC ?= cl /nologo ;\n",
|
||||||
"CCFLAGS ?= /D \\\"WIN\\\" ;\n",
|
"CCFLAGS ?= /D \\\"WIN\\\" ;\n",
|
||||||
"C++ ?= $(CC) ;\n",
|
"C++ ?= $(CC) ;\n",
|
||||||
@ -31,6 +32,7 @@ const char *jambase[] = {
|
|||||||
"MSVCNT ?= $(MSVCDIR) ;\n",
|
"MSVCNT ?= $(MSVCDIR) ;\n",
|
||||||
"local I ; if $(OSPLAT) = IA64 { I = ia64\\\\ ; } else { I = \"\" ; }\n",
|
"local I ; if $(OSPLAT) = IA64 { I = ia64\\\\ ; } else { I = \"\" ; }\n",
|
||||||
"AR ?= lib ;\n",
|
"AR ?= lib ;\n",
|
||||||
|
"ARFLAGS ?= ;\n",
|
||||||
"AS ?= masm386 ;\n",
|
"AS ?= masm386 ;\n",
|
||||||
"CC ?= cl /nologo ;\n",
|
"CC ?= cl /nologo ;\n",
|
||||||
"CCFLAGS ?= \"\" ;\n",
|
"CCFLAGS ?= \"\" ;\n",
|
||||||
@ -56,7 +58,8 @@ const char *jambase[] = {
|
|||||||
"RANLIB ?= \"ranlib\" ;\n",
|
"RANLIB ?= \"ranlib\" ;\n",
|
||||||
"SUFEXE ?= .exe ;\n",
|
"SUFEXE ?= .exe ;\n",
|
||||||
"} else if $(OS) = BEOS && $(OSPLAT) = PPC {\n",
|
"} else if $(OS) = BEOS && $(OSPLAT) = PPC {\n",
|
||||||
"AR ?= mwld -xml -o ;\n",
|
"AR ?= mwld ;\n",
|
||||||
|
"ARFLAGS ?= -xml -o ;\n",
|
||||||
"BINDIR ?= /boot/home/config/bin ;\n",
|
"BINDIR ?= /boot/home/config/bin ;\n",
|
||||||
"CC ?= mwcc ;\n",
|
"CC ?= mwcc ;\n",
|
||||||
"CCFLAGS ?= -nosyspath ;\n",
|
"CCFLAGS ?= -nosyspath ;\n",
|
||||||
@ -96,7 +99,7 @@ const char *jambase[] = {
|
|||||||
"YACCFILES ?= y.tab ;\n",
|
"YACCFILES ?= y.tab ;\n",
|
||||||
"YACCFLAGS ?= -d ;\n",
|
"YACCFLAGS ?= -d ;\n",
|
||||||
"} else if $(OS) = HAIKU {\n",
|
"} else if $(OS) = HAIKU {\n",
|
||||||
"BINDIR ?= /boot/common/bin ;\n",
|
"BINDIR ?= /boot/system/non-packaged/bin ;\n",
|
||||||
"CC ?= gcc ;\n",
|
"CC ?= gcc ;\n",
|
||||||
"C++ ?= $(CC) ;\n",
|
"C++ ?= $(CC) ;\n",
|
||||||
"CHMOD ?= chmod ;\n",
|
"CHMOD ?= chmod ;\n",
|
||||||
@ -104,11 +107,11 @@ const char *jambase[] = {
|
|||||||
"CHOWN ?= chown ;\n",
|
"CHOWN ?= chown ;\n",
|
||||||
"FORTRAN ?= \"\" ;\n",
|
"FORTRAN ?= \"\" ;\n",
|
||||||
"LEX ?= flex ;\n",
|
"LEX ?= flex ;\n",
|
||||||
"LIBDIR ?= /boot/common/lib ;\n",
|
"LIBDIR ?= /boot/system/non-packaged/lib ;\n",
|
||||||
"LINK ?= gcc ;\n",
|
"LINK ?= gcc ;\n",
|
||||||
"MANDIR ?= /boot/common/man ;\n",
|
"MANDIR ?= /boot/system/non-packaged/documentation/man ;\n",
|
||||||
"RANLIB ?= ranlib ;\n",
|
"RANLIB ?= ranlib ;\n",
|
||||||
"STDHDRS ?= /boot/develop/headers/posix ;\n",
|
"STDHDRS ?= /boot/system/develop/headers/posix ;\n",
|
||||||
"YACC ?= bison -y ;\n",
|
"YACC ?= bison -y ;\n",
|
||||||
"YACCGEN ?= .c ;\n",
|
"YACCGEN ?= .c ;\n",
|
||||||
"YACCFILES ?= y.tab ;\n",
|
"YACCFILES ?= y.tab ;\n",
|
||||||
@ -129,6 +132,7 @@ const char *jambase[] = {
|
|||||||
"MANDIR ?= /usr/local/share/man ;\n",
|
"MANDIR ?= /usr/local/share/man ;\n",
|
||||||
"case QNX :\n",
|
"case QNX :\n",
|
||||||
"AR ?= wlib ;\n",
|
"AR ?= wlib ;\n",
|
||||||
|
"ARFLAGS ?= ;\n",
|
||||||
"CC ?= cc ;\n",
|
"CC ?= cc ;\n",
|
||||||
"CCFLAGS ?= -Q ; # quiet\n",
|
"CCFLAGS ?= -Q ; # quiet\n",
|
||||||
"C++ ?= $(CC) ;\n",
|
"C++ ?= $(CC) ;\n",
|
||||||
@ -152,7 +156,8 @@ const char *jambase[] = {
|
|||||||
"YACCFILES ?= y.tab ;\n",
|
"YACCFILES ?= y.tab ;\n",
|
||||||
"YACCFLAGS ?= -d ;\n",
|
"YACCFLAGS ?= -d ;\n",
|
||||||
"}\n",
|
"}\n",
|
||||||
"AR ?= ar r ;\n",
|
"AR ?= ar ;\n",
|
||||||
|
"ARFLAGS ?= r ;\n",
|
||||||
"AS ?= as ;\n",
|
"AS ?= as ;\n",
|
||||||
"ASFLAGS ?= ;\n",
|
"ASFLAGS ?= ;\n",
|
||||||
"AWK ?= awk ;\n",
|
"AWK ?= awk ;\n",
|
||||||
@ -749,7 +754,7 @@ const char *jambase[] = {
|
|||||||
"}\n",
|
"}\n",
|
||||||
"actions updated together piecemeal Archive\n",
|
"actions updated together piecemeal Archive\n",
|
||||||
"{\n",
|
"{\n",
|
||||||
"$(AR) $(<) $(>)\n",
|
"$(AR) $(ARFLAGS) $(<) $(>)\n",
|
||||||
"}\n",
|
"}\n",
|
||||||
"actions As\n",
|
"actions As\n",
|
||||||
"{\n",
|
"{\n",
|
||||||
|
Loading…
Reference in New Issue
Block a user